From fd590e9199cce0c27e70dbed5b7d4cde76e0d220 Mon Sep 17 00:00:00 2001 From: Jose Maldonado aka Yukiteru Date: Mon, 29 Apr 2024 15:12:43 -0400 Subject: [PATCH] Fix exec_path in profiles for Edge and copyright headers --- apparmor.d/profiles-m-r/msedge | 4 ++-- apparmor.d/profiles-m-r/msedge-crashpad-handlers | 4 ++-- apparmor.d/profiles-m-r/msedge-sandbox | 4 ++-- apparmor.d/profiles-m-r/msedge-wrapper | 4 ++-- 4 files changed, 8 insertions(+), 8 deletions(-) diff --git a/apparmor.d/profiles-m-r/msedge b/apparmor.d/profiles-m-r/msedge index a45f0b0a..6c92c17c 100644 --- a/apparmor.d/profiles-m-r/msedge +++ b/apparmor.d/profiles-m-r/msedge @@ -1,6 +1,6 @@ # apparmor.d - Full set of apparmor profiles -# Copyright (C) 2018-2021 Mikhail Morfikov # Copyright (C) 2022-2024 Alexandre Pujol +# Copyright (C) 2022-2024 Jose Maldonado # SPDX-License-Identifier: GPL-2.0-only abi , @@ -14,7 +14,7 @@ include @{cache_dirs} = @{user_cache_dirs}/microsoft-edge{,-beta,-dev} @{exec_path} = @{lib_dirs}/@{name} -profile msedge /opt/microsoft/msedge{,-beta,-dev}/msedge{,-beta,-dev} { +profile msedge @{exec_path} { include include diff --git a/apparmor.d/profiles-m-r/msedge-crashpad-handlers b/apparmor.d/profiles-m-r/msedge-crashpad-handlers index c9572f50..6f453c65 100644 --- a/apparmor.d/profiles-m-r/msedge-crashpad-handlers +++ b/apparmor.d/profiles-m-r/msedge-crashpad-handlers @@ -1,6 +1,6 @@ # apparmor.d - Full set of apparmor profiles -# Copyright (C) 2018-2022 Mikhail Morfikov # Copyright (C) 2022-2024 Alexandre Pujol +# Copyright (C) 2022-2024 Jose Maldonado # SPDX-License-Identifier: GPL-2.0-only abi , @@ -11,7 +11,7 @@ include @{config_dirs} = @{user_config_dirs}/microsoft-edge{,-beta,-dev} @{exec_path} = @{lib_dirs}/msedge_crashpad_handler -profile msedge-crashpad-handler /opt/microsoft/msedge{,-beta,-dev}/msedge_crashpad_handler { +profile msedge-crashpad-handler @{exec_path} { include capability sys_ptrace, diff --git a/apparmor.d/profiles-m-r/msedge-sandbox b/apparmor.d/profiles-m-r/msedge-sandbox index e113c586..f8192145 100644 --- a/apparmor.d/profiles-m-r/msedge-sandbox +++ b/apparmor.d/profiles-m-r/msedge-sandbox @@ -1,6 +1,6 @@ # apparmor.d - Full set of apparmor profiles -# Copyright (C) 2018-2021 Mikhail Morfikov # Copyright (C) 2022-2024 Alexandre Pujol +# Copyright (C) 2022-2024 Jose Maldonado # SPDX-License-Identifier: GPL-2.0-only abi , @@ -10,7 +10,7 @@ include @{lib_dirs} = /opt/microsoft/msedge{,-beta,-dev} @{exec_path} = @{lib_dirs}/msedge-sandbox -profile msedge-sandbox /opt/microsoft/msedge{,-beta,-dev}/msedge-sandbox { +profile msedge-sandbox @{exec_path} { include capability setgid, diff --git a/apparmor.d/profiles-m-r/msedge-wrapper b/apparmor.d/profiles-m-r/msedge-wrapper index 3b90f399..b35fbdd3 100644 --- a/apparmor.d/profiles-m-r/msedge-wrapper +++ b/apparmor.d/profiles-m-r/msedge-wrapper @@ -1,6 +1,6 @@ # apparmor.d - Full set of apparmor profiles -# Copyright (C) 2018-2021 Mikhail Morfikov # Copyright (C) 2022-2024 Alexandre Pujol +# Copyright (C) 2022-2024 Jose Maldonado # SPDX-License-Identifier: GPL-2.0-only abi , @@ -10,7 +10,7 @@ include @{lib_dirs} = /opt/microsoft/msedge{,-beta,-dev} @{exec_path} = @{lib_dirs}/microsoft-edge{,-beta,-dev} -profile msedge-wrapper /opt/microsoft/msedge{,-beta,-dev}/microsoft-edge{,-beta,-dev} flags=(attach_disconnected) { +profile msedge-wrapper @{exec_path} flags=(attach_disconnected) { include include